Loureirin C is a bioactive flavonoid compound derived from the roots of the plant Spatholobus suberectus, which has a long history of traditional medicinal use in Chinese and Korean herbal medicine. It exhibits a wide range of potential pharmacological activities, such as anti-inflammatory, antioxidant, anti-cancer, and cardiovascular protective effects, making it a promising candidate for the development of new therapeutic agents.

Check Digit Verification of cas no

The CAS Registry Mumber 116384-24-8 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,6,3,8 and 4 respectively; the second part has 2 digits, 2 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 116384-24:
(8*1)+(7*1)+(6*6)+(5*3)+(4*8)+(3*4)+(2*2)+(1*4)=118
118 % 10 = 8
So 116384-24-8 is a valid CAS Registry Number.

FLAVONOID AND OTHER CONSTITUENTS OF BAUHINIA MANCA

Achenbach, Hans,Stoecker, Markus,Constenla, Manuel A.

, p. 1835 - 1842 (2007/10/02)

Phytochemical analysis of the stem of Bauhinia manca yielded 63 compounds, among them six new natural products.Major constituents were found to be 3-O-galloylepicatechin, gallic acid, cinnamic acid, β-sitosterol and its β-D-glucoside.The two new flavans possess significant antifungal activity.Key Word Index-Bauhinia manca; Leguminosae; 5,5-dimethoxylariciresinol; 4-O-methylisoliquiritigenin; 4'-O-methylliquiritigenin; 7,3'-dimethoxy-4-hydroxyflavan; 3',4'-dihydroxy-7-methoxyflavan; 2,4'-dihydroxy-4-methoxydihydrochalcone; antimicrobial activity.
